Discovery of Orally Bioavailable Purine-Based Inhibitors of the Low-Molecular-Weight Protein Tyrosine Phosphatase

Obesity-associated insulin resistance
plays a central role in the
pathogenesis of type 2 diabetes. A promising approach to decrease
insulin resistance in obesity is to inhibit the protein tyrosine phosphatases
that negatively regulate insulin receptor signaling. The low-molecular-weight
protein tyrosine phosphatase (LMPTP) acts as a critical promoter of
insulin resistance in obesity by inhibiting phosphorylation of the
liver insulin receptor activation motif. Here, we report development
of a novel purine-based chemical series of LMPTP inhibitors. These
compounds inhibit LMPTP with an uncompetitive mechanism and are highly
selective for LMPTP over other protein tyrosine phosphatases. We also
report the generation of a highly orally bioavailable purine-based
analogue that reverses obesity-induced diabetes in mice.
